HEIGHT ADJUSTMENT OF LIFTING
TIE-RODS
Lifting tie-rod, LH - Fig. (A):
After disconnecting the upper end of the
lifting tie-rod from pin of the lifting arm of
hydraulic system, rotate the eye (1) to
carry out the adjustment.
Lifting tie-rod, RH - Fig. (B):
Move the sliding T-handle (2) in the
arrow direction and rotate it to reach the
desired adjustment.
FIXED AND FREE POSITIONS OF
HYDRAULIC SYSTEM LOWER TIE-
RODS
Fixed position of hydraulic system lower
tie-rods - see Fig. (A):
The pinhead (1) and washer (2) are
installed horizontally.
Free position of hydraulic system lower
tie-rods - see Fig. (B):
The pinhead (1) and washer (2) are
installed vertically.
Free position allows a free attachment of
tractor and implement. Both ends of tie-
rods can move freely in height one to-
wards another in that case.
LIMITING RODS
Limiting rods (1) allow the side swinging of
lower tie-rods.
Turn the rod tube to adjust the left and
the right limiting rod - see the arrow.
Always both limiting rods must be
installed on the tractor.
